When conducting an entity search, stakeholders can access a wealth of details, including the business’s name, registration number, date of incorporation, status (active or inactive), and the names of its officers and directors. This transparency fosters trust and accountability in the business community, which is key for economic growth and stability.
While LLC entity lookup directories offer numerous benefits, there are some challenges and considerations to keep in mind. First, the accuracy of the details can vary depending on the source. Official state directories are generally reliable, but third-party websites may not always have up-to-date or complete data. Stakeholders should cross-reference data with official sources whenever possible.
